In China, with one or two parents going outto earn money, many children are left in their hometown in the countryside.These children are called “leftover children”. A large number of leftoverchildren have emerged since 1978, and the statistics showed in 2004, the totalis 22 million.

Usually their grandparents or theirparents’ friends or relatives look after these leftover children. Sometimesthey are brought up by one of their parents at home. In most cases, theirguardians are not quite educed. To them, making sure that the children arehealthy and fed well is the most important task, and that the children are safeand sound is considered to have done a good job. But they seldom care aboutchildren’s study, their psychological needs, or mental demands. Neither do theyspend some time teaching kids how to develop good habits.

Therefore ,for most of the time, theleftover children can’t get emotional support from their parents, which canresult in so many problems.
